247 AM Radio Network (247 AMRN)

Loading...
247 AM Radio Network is a local & national internet radio based in Washington DC. AMRN will create a platform for local talent to gain
internet-radios.live
247 AM Radio Network is a local & national internet radio based in Washington DC. AMRN will create a platform for local talent to gain